Can We Escape Control of The Wire?

Guest Post by Tom Luongo

What is The Wire?  

Why is it so important?

Who controls it?

Answer those three questions and you can answer a number of problems plaguing our world today.

The Wire is simply a metaphor for the transmission of information.  The Wire takes many forms.  And if you aren’t sure whether something is The Wire just ask if you have control over it or not.

The Internet?  The Wire.

Electricity?  The Wire

Roads?  The Wire.

Media?  The Wire.

Money?  The Wire.

In short, The Wire is the main conduit through which we communicate with each other.  Money?  Really?  Yes, really.  What are prices if not information about what we are willing to part with our money in exchange for?

Without The Wire modern society fails.  So, government can’t shut it down but neither can it allow unconstrained access to it.

Electricity, commerce, communications, everything, goes over The Wire.  

This isn’t a radical concept but like all important ideas, once it is presented to you you can’t unsee it.

But, identifying The Wire isn’t the important thing.  What’s important is knowing who controls The Wire and what they are willing to do to maintain that control.

If you look at all of the things listed above you will see massive government intervention into these markets.  They need control of them to maintain the illusion they have control over you.

They sell you on the idea that speech, speed, education, commerce, defense, information, etc.  all need to have sensible limits placed on them.  But do they really or is this just yet another example of some jackass talking his book?

Look around you today and tell me what all the fighting is about.  Geopolitics, domestic policy, censorship, money, advertising, ideologies, etc.  They are all about the existential threat posed by a loss of control of The Wire.

In fact, everything I talk about here at Gold Goats ‘n Guns is about this very subject.  Who has control and are they or are they not losing it?

The Wire is the primary means of control over our society.  

Those who seek to accumulate power can only see things in terms of controlling The Wire. And it is why nothing ever seems to get fixed.  Every time technology breaks down their artificial control over a major market — food, energy, communications, transport — we see them shift their focus to rein it in, control it, neuter it and make it work for them rather than you.

The Internet is the greatest invention of all time because it gave the world a solution to The Wire.  No one owned it, ultimately.  It gave everyone a cheap, reliable communications platform which has revolutionized (not always in a good way) the way humans coordinate their activities.

It is creating new businesses and technologies today faster than we humans can integrate the last ones into our daily routines.  It has accelerated the elimination of poverty through more efficient supply chain management making goods and services arrive faster and cheaper than ever before.

All of that time we used to spend in places like libraries, DMV’s and supermarket we now spend at home screaming at each other about how bad we all have it.

And what have the Scions of Control done everything in their power to do?  Control it.  Bind it down.  Make it worse.  Criminalize the use of it in unapproved ways.

And now, via Google, Apple, Facebook and Twitter, limit your access to the parts of it where it is easiest and most effective for you to commit the sin of criticizing them.

Because if you want to know who controls The Wire just look to whom you are not allowed to criticize.

The EU is trying to make memes illegal by forcing attribution to the original work, solving a problem no one wanted solved, except them.  Net neutrality?  Another solution in search of a problem.

The global monetary system modernized on the back of the Internet is also at risk of its excesses collapsing in on itself.  Because with this obsessive need to control The Wire comes the malinvestment of capital in enterprises which support this need for control — surveillance, military, banking, legal services, insurance.

It over-emphasizes bureaucracy to slow growth and hamper innovation.  Entrepreneurs gravitate towards those markets supported by and subsidized by government control.

It crowds out investment in the productive portion of the society, the one most efficiently funded through pooled community savings.  Control of The Wire is so acute among the global elite we manage our economy based on the completely backwards notion known as the paradox of thrift.
